“Most of the people in my area of duty are Pashtun. I am Pashtun and I talk tot he community in their own language. My frequent visits and friendly behaviour with the community have paid off – when i visit them, I never feel a stranger. They receive me like one of their own! We establish good relations to build trust, we share with them in moments of happiness and grief.
The area where I work is now free of polio. Now mothers realise the risk of polio and how to protect their children.”
Shagufta’s words were taken from this End Polio Pakistan video.
